4 SCOTTA ROAD is a small extended terraced house of 71m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929, which could now be worth an estimated £163,453. It was last sold for £145,000 in July 2023, which was around 27% below the average July 2023 terraced price in the Salford local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was January 2023,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.
Land registry data shows four sales for 4 SCOTTA ROAD since 1st January 1995.
